
All the other buildings have been razed. These administration buildings are all that's left of the site of Downey's aeronautic history, from the first airport in 1929, through Consolidated Vultee Aircraft in 1943, to the various aeronautics companies that worked on the Apollo, Saturn, and space shuttle programs. Eventually, this will be the Tierra Luna Marketplace.

I don't know what the plans are for these buildings. But I will be very sad if all this construction means losing the old Vultee logo that graces the floor of the round building above. (Click here to see the building and logo as it appeared a year and a half ago.)
